Mercedes is a taxi dancer--in a town where taxi dancers have gone the way of the penny arcade--who aspires to become a famous actress. She is in love with Harry, an aging TV actor so has-been that his big comeback gig has him dressed in a gorilla suit. Mercedes' colleague on the dance floor, Jackie, is a slim, tall, copper-headed transvestite who looks really--really--beautiful in blue sequins. But it is Mercedes' sweetly innocent relationship with Ernesto, a hopelessly romantic admirer, that is at the film's emotional core.
